Output 8a9586bd611f69ae46ca8ba156f9c151937d80a6b4e9975da9950d50c76fa9c6:1

value
6509462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3587894fcd4f9995d9c35b308f721af1189ca99 OP_EQUAL
address
3LxWV6RxM9dW1vsKzEGiankQbNFv9GZQyv
transaction
8a9586bd611f69ae46ca8ba156f9c151937d80a6b4e9975da9950d50c76fa9c6
spent
true